North Ridgeville schools report strong year, construction under way ahead of Aug. 15 groundbreaking

At its June 3 meeting, the North Ridgeville City Board of Education heard the superintendent report that the district closed the school year with improved testing, successful graduation at Ranger Stadium and active construction at the Bainbridge campus; the district confirmed an Aug. 15 back-to-school kickoff and official groundbreaking.

The North Ridgeville City Board of Education heard an end-of-year report Tuesday that highlighted student testing gains, a successful graduation at Ranger Stadium and active construction on the Bainbridge campus ahead of a planned Aug. 15 back-to-school kickoff and official groundbreaking.

The superintendent said testing was completed despite state-linked technical problems and credited building principals, the curriculum department and technology teams with helping students finish state assessments. "We are very proud of our students and our staff for their hard work throughout this past year," the superintendent said.
